By the editors · 2 min readck one Shock for Her opens with a fleeting burst of peony before diving into something richer and stranger. The heart is where it lives: dark cocoa mingles with jammy blackberry and narcissus, creating a sweetness that feels indulgent without tipping into dessert territory. There's a fruity-floral haze that lingers, almost syrupy, but grounded by jasmine's presence.

The base steadies things with amber and patchouli, though vanilla keeps the overall effect soft and pillowy. The musk adds warmth rather than edge. This is Calvin Klein leaning into maximalism—louder and sweeter than the minimalist ck one that preceded it, aimed at someone who wants their fragrance noticed. It wears youthful and bold, best suited to cool weather when its chocolatey richness won't overwhelm.
